摘 要: 以水玻璃、无机酸和氯化铁为原料制备了含铁聚硅酸(FPS),对其制备过程中的若干影响因素进行了研究.结果表明:以活化时间为1h、Fe/Si比为1时,所制备的FPS具有最佳混凝性能.同时对其混凝特性进行了初步研究,表明FPS具有较宽的pH适用范围,并且形成絮体速度快、絮体结实粗大.与聚合铁进行混凝对比表明,FPS具有更优的混凝除浊性能. A new kind of inorganic polymer flocculant——Ferric Polysilicate(FPS) was prepared by using water glass,ferric chloride and inorganic acid as material. Several factors of preparation were discussed. The experimental results showed that FPS was best prepared at Fe/Si ratio of 1 and activation time of one hour. Compared with PFC, FPS showed better capability of turbidity removal.
